CC Switch终极指南:7大AI工具一键切换的完整教程

【免费下载链接】cc-switch A cross-platform desktop All-in-One assistant for Claude Code, Codex, OpenCode, OpenClaw, Gemini CLI & Hermes Agent. Only official website: ccswitch.io 【免费下载链接】cc-switch 项目地址: https://gitcode.com/GitHub_Trending/cc/cc-switch

CC Switch是一款跨平台桌面AI助手工具,专为管理Claude Code、Claude Desktop、Codex、Gemini CLI、OpenCode、OpenClaw和Hermes Agent等七大主流AI编程工具而设计。通过统一的视觉界面,你可以轻松管理50多个预设提供商配置,实现一键切换、MCP服务器统一管理、技能仓库同步等强大功能,彻底告别手动编辑配置文件的繁琐操作!🚀

为什么你需要CC Switch?

现代AI编程工作流中,你可能会同时使用多个工具:Claude Code用于代码补全、Codex用于代码生成、Gemini CLI用于命令行交互……每个工具都有自己独特的配置格式,切换API提供商需要手动编辑JSON、TOML或.env文件,过程繁琐且容易出错。

CC Switch解决了这个痛点!它提供了一个统一的桌面应用程序,让你能够:

  • 一键管理7大AI工具:无需在不同工具间来回切换
  • 50+预设提供商:包括AWS Bedrock、NVIDIA NIM和社区中继服务
  • 统一MCP和技能管理:跨Claude、Codex、Gemini等工具的集中管理
  • 系统托盘快速切换:无需打开完整应用即可切换提供商
  • 云同步支持:通过Dropbox、OneDrive、iCloud或WebDAV同步配置

CC Switch主界面展示

快速入门:3分钟完成首次配置

第一步:安装CC Switch

根据你的操作系统选择合适的安装方式:

Windows用户:下载最新的MSI安装包或便携版ZIP文件

macOS用户(推荐使用Homebrew):

brew install --cask cc-switch

Linux用户:下载DEB、RPM或AppImage格式的安装包

第二步:添加第一个AI提供商

安装完成后,打开CC Switch,点击"添加提供商"按钮。你会看到一个直观的界面,列出了所有可用的预设配置:

添加AI提供商界面

选择你需要的提供商预设(如MiniMax、DeepSeek、Zhipu GLM等),系统会自动填充API端点,你只需要输入API密钥即可完成配置。大多数预设已经包含了正确的端点URL,大大简化了配置过程。

第三步:一键切换提供商

配置完成后,你可以通过两种方式切换提供商:

  1. 主界面切换:在提供商列表中选择目标提供商,点击"启用"按钮
  2. 系统托盘快速切换:点击系统托盘中的CC Switch图标,直接从菜单中选择提供商

对于Claude Code,切换是即时生效的,无需重启终端。对于其他工具,可能需要重启相应的CLI工具才能生效。

核心功能深度解析

🔧 提供商管理:告别手动配置

CC Switch的提供商管理系统支持7种AI工具和50多个预设配置。无论你是使用Claude Code、Codex还是Gemini CLI,都可以在同一个界面中管理所有配置。

预设提供商包括

  • AWS Bedrock、NVIDIA NIM等官方渠道
  • 社区中继服务如MiniMax、DeepSeek、Zhipu GLM
  • 自定义配置支持任意兼容的API端点

统一提供商功能:一个配置可以同时同步到Claude Code、Codex和Gemini CLI,实现真正的"一次配置,多处使用"。

扩展提供商预设列表

🌐 代理与故障转移:确保服务高可用

CC Switch内置了强大的代理和故障转移功能:

  • 本地代理热切换:支持格式转换、自动故障转移、熔断机制
  • 应用级接管:可以独立代理Claude、Codex或Gemini,甚至细化到单个提供商
  • 健康监控:实时监控提供商健康状态,自动切换到备用服务
  • 请求整流器:优化API请求,提高响应速度和稳定性

🧩 MCP、提示词与技能统一管理

MCP服务器管理:统一的MCP面板让你可以跨Claude、Codex、Gemini、OpenCode和Hermes管理MCP服务器,支持双向同步和深度链接导入。

提示词管理:内置Markdown编辑器,支持跨应用同步(CLAUDE.md / AGENTS.md / GEMINI.md),并提供回填保护机制。

技能仓库管理:一键从GitHub仓库或ZIP文件安装技能,支持自定义仓库管理、符号链接和文件复制功能。

📊 用量与成本跟踪

CC Switch提供了详细的用量统计仪表板:

  • 花费追踪:实时监控API使用费用
  • 请求统计:记录成功和失败的API请求
  • 令牌计数:精确统计输入和输出令牌
  • 趋势图表:可视化展示使用趋势
  • 自定义定价:支持按模型设置自定义价格

💾 会话管理器与工作空间

会话管理器:浏览、搜索和恢复跨支持会话源的对话历史记录。

工作空间编辑器(OpenClaw):编辑代理文件(AGENTS.md、SOUL.md等),支持Markdown预览功能。

高级功能:ccswitch://深度链接协议

CC Switch最强大的功能之一是其深度链接协议ccswitch://。这个协议让你可以通过一个简单的URL链接快速导入各种配置,彻底改变了配置分享和部署的方式。

什么是ccswitch://协议?

ccswitch://是CC Switch的自定义URL协议,专门用于快速导入AI配置。它采用标准化的URL格式,支持多种资源类型和参数配置,让你的AI工作流更加高效流畅。

支持的资源类型

  1. 提供商配置导入:快速添加新的AI提供商
  2. 提示词导入:导入预设的提示词模板
  3. MCP服务器配置导入:批量导入MCP服务器配置
  4. 技能仓库导入:快速配置GitHub技能仓库

使用示例

一个典型的ccswitch://链接看起来像这样:

ccswitch://v1/import?resource=provider&app=claude&name=测试提供商&homepage=https://example.com&endpoint=https://api.example.com/v1&apiKey=sk-test-key&model=claude-sonnet-4&icon=claude

安全特性

CC Switch在显示ccswitch://链接中的敏感信息时,会自动进行脱敏处理。API密钥只显示前4个字符,其余用星号代替,确保你的配置安全。

实用场景与应用技巧

🏢 团队协作配置共享

团队管理员可以生成标准的ccswitch://链接,新成员只需点击链接即可获得相同的配置环境,大大简化了团队配置流程。

🌐 社区配置分享

在技术社区中分享优秀的提供商配置、提示词模板等,让更多人受益于最佳实践。

🔄 多设备同步

通过CC Switch的云同步功能,你可以在多台设备间同步配置。支持Dropbox、OneDrive、iCloud或WebDAV服务器,确保无论在哪台设备上工作,都能获得一致的AI助手体验。

🛠️ 故障排除与恢复

CC Switch提供了完善的备份和恢复机制:

  • 自动备份:保留最近10个配置备份
  • 原子写入:防止配置文件损坏
  • 并发安全:避免竞态条件导致的数据不一致

数据存储与安全性

你的所有配置数据都安全地存储在本地:

  • 数据库~/.cc-switch/cc-switch.db(SQLite - 提供商、MCP、提示词、技能)
  • 本地设置~/.cc-switch/settings.json(设备级UI偏好设置)
  • 备份~/.cc-switch/backups/(自动轮换,保留最近10个)
  • 技能~/.cc-switch/skills/(默认符号链接到相应应用)

常见问题解答

❓ 哪些AI工具支持CC Switch?

CC Switch支持七大工具:Claude CodeClaude DesktopCodexGemini CLIOpenCodeOpenClawHermes。每个工具都有专用的提供商预设和配置管理。

🔄 切换提供商后需要重启终端吗?

对于大多数工具,是的——需要重启终端或CLI工具才能使更改生效。Claude Code是个例外,它目前支持提供商数据的热切换,无需重启。

📁 如何切换回官方登录?

从预设列表中添加一个"官方登录"提供商。切换到它后,运行登出/登录流程,然后就可以在官方提供商和第三方提供商之间自由切换了。Codex支持在不同官方提供商之间切换,方便在多个Plus或团队账户之间切换。

🔧 插件配置在切换提供商后消失了怎么办?

CC Switch提供了"共享配置片段"功能,可以在提供商之间传递公共数据(除了API密钥和端点)。转到"编辑提供商"→"共享配置面板"→点击"从当前提供商提取"保存所有公共数据。创建新提供商时,勾选"写入共享配置"(默认启用)以在新提供商中包含插件数据。

技术架构与设计理念

CC Switch采用现代化的技术栈构建:

前端:React 18、TypeScript、Vite、TailwindCSS 3.4、TanStack Query v5 后端:Tauri 2.8、Rust、SQLite 测试:vitest、MSW、@testing-library/react

核心设计模式

  • 单一事实来源:所有数据存储在~/.cc-switch/cc-switch.db(SQLite)
  • 双层级存储:SQLite用于可同步数据,JSON用于设备级设置
  • 双向同步:切换时写入实时文件,编辑活动提供商时从实时文件回填
  • 原子写入:临时文件+重命名模式防止配置损坏
  • 并发安全:互斥锁保护的数据库连接避免竞态条件

开始使用CC Switch

现在你已经了解了CC Switch的强大功能,是时候开始使用了!无论你是个人开发者还是团队协作,CC Switch都能显著提升你的AI编程工作效率。

记住,CC Switch的核心价值在于简化复杂性。不再需要手动编辑配置文件,不再需要在不同工具间来回切换,不再担心配置丢失或损坏。一切都在一个统一的界面中管理,一切都可以通过几次点击完成。

开始你的高效AI编程之旅吧!💪

【免费下载链接】cc-switch A cross-platform desktop All-in-One assistant for Claude Code, Codex, OpenCode, OpenClaw, Gemini CLI & Hermes Agent. Only official website: ccswitch.io 【免费下载链接】cc-switch 项目地址: https://gitcode.com/GitHub_Trending/cc/cc-switch

Logo

欢迎加入 MCP 技术社区!与志同道合者携手前行,一同解锁 MCP 技术的无限可能!

更多推荐